华科不平凡
华科不平凡
全部文章
分类
题解(135)
归档
标签
去牛客网
登录
/
注册
ioogle
why join the navy if you can be a pirate
TA的专栏
135篇文章
8人订阅
刷遍天下无敌手
135篇文章
15888人学习
2333
0篇文章
0人学习
全部文章
(共3篇)
换位词
来自专栏
思路:利用unordered_map和unordered_set 前者保存根据字母排序后的单词以及对应的原始单词 如果某一个原始单词已经插入结果,那么将其记录在unordered_set,防止重复插入 代码如下: // // Created by jt on 2020/9/29. // #inc...
unordered_set
unordered_map
2020-09-29
0
941
词语序列ii
来自专栏
从hit到cog之间有许多路径,我们可以将其想像成一个图: 两种方法: BFS记录每个单词所在层再DFS,176ms, 2924KB 构建图再回溯,156ms, 4580KB 方法一:BFS记录图中单词所在层再DFS 先通过BFS记录图里面单词所在的层,然后通过DFS找到所有的路径: BF...
DFS
unordered_set
unordered_map
深度优先搜索
回溯
图
BFS
2020-09-24
0
941
最长的连续元素序列长度
来自专栏
采用哈希表存储每个元素,然后遍历整个数组,遍历的时候求当前元素所在连续序列的长度。 如[3, 1, 2, 8, 9],存到哈希表之后,我们遍历这个数组,首先遇到的是3,我们在哈希表中查找3之前的连续数,以及查找3之后的连续数,查完就从哈希表中删除(因为是连续的,所以删除不会影响最终结果),并且更新结...
unordered_set
2020-09-23
3
893